Texas
Relationship Recognition Information
| no | Licenses marriages for same-sex couples. |
| no | Honors marriages of same-sex couples from other jurisdictions. |
| no | Relationship recognition for same-sex couples: None. |
- 2005 Constitutional amendment banning same-sex marriage. See Texas Constitution, Article I, § 32.
- 2003 Same-sex marriage and civil unions prohibited by statute. See Texas Family Code § 6.204.
- 1997 Marrige licenses denied to same-sex couples. See Texas Family Code § 2.001.

Parenting Information
| Who May Adopt | Any adult. Tex. Fam. Code. § 162.001 |
|---|---|
| Second Parent Adoptions | Approved in lower courts. |
| Notes | Varying tolerance but frequent hostility to LGBT parents. |
